Design consideration of non-contact feeding system

Kenta Katoh、Masayuki Morimoto2010-12-10International Conference on Electrical Machines and Systems

The design method of the non-contacting feeding system will be shown. In this paper, FEM analysis is used for the design. The iron loss is the key factor of the system design. The core material and frequency should be decided by iron loss. By the method, high efficiency non-contact feeding system can be designed.
